Output 43859d966f7a8716d0f07efba09f5b6f762fdaf70e39c0d6666d25feaa6788c3:1

value
397009096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1b5bc145c56f971a96d34a85b8c437c9df7d91 OP_EQUAL
address
3PJiquNWEJJTFU13WE5D7uiTQzx8DdEPzp
transaction
43859d966f7a8716d0f07efba09f5b6f762fdaf70e39c0d6666d25feaa6788c3
confirmations
283281
spent
true